Tigers trade pitcher to Nats for 3 players

The busy Detroit Tigers traded right-hander Doug Fister to the Washington Nationals for three players on Monday night in a deal between teams with deep rotations. Detroit acquired infielder Steve Lombardozzi, minor league left-hander Robbie Ray and reliever Ian Krol for Fister, a 14-game winner for the AL Central champions.

Tigers President and General Manager Dave Dombrowski said the trade was not done to save money in hopes of keeping Max Scherzer beyond next season.

Dombrowski said dealing Fister didn’t have anything to do with his hope to give Scherzer, the AL Cy Young Award winner, a new contract before he becomes a free agent after the 2014 season. Detroit has had an active offseason so far, and Dombrowski said he isn’t done making moves, saying his top priority is to add a closer. AP
